One of my very first jobs in Hollywood was for Golden Era Productions. I was young and dumb, and had no idea this was the in-house propaganda machine for Scientology. I filmed a small part in a training video. It was the strangest experience.

Everyone I encountered was overly cheerful in a way that felt forced. When not filming, we were corralled in a library and watched by a minder the whole time. Everyone was dressed exactly the same (blue shirt/khaki pants). I’m nosy, so I looked through the books. I was shocked by the number of books written by Bart Simpson/aka Nancy Cartwright. A little part of my childhood died when I found out Bart was one of them. Their buildings are cavernous, guarded by dudes with guns, mostly empty of people and dripping with money. They gave me TONS of their promotional material and mentioned opportunities for further work. I cashed my check and never looked back. They still send me the odd email to this day... ten years later. They are a scary and persistent bunch with deep connections to the entertainment business. I was warned to avoid a particular acting school they supposedly ran (The Beverly Hills Playhouse). Apparently, they used it to recruit vulnerable, desperate people with dreams of stardom. I have no doubt that’s still happening. Business must be booming, since they have expanded and now have their own movie studio out in Hemet, CA.
